WARNING:

 

•Not for infants under 12 months of age
•Children must be able to hold head up with helmets on
•Children must always use seat belt and bike helmets
•Never leave child unattended
•Always ride defensively
•Do not exceed 100 LB total weight.
•Maximum 2 passengers - Maximum weight 50 LB per child
•Maximum passenger height 42 Inches
•Do not exceed 10 MPH maximum speed, slower for turns or rough roads
•Braking Distances are increased when pulling the trailer.  Slow down and allow extra stopping distance.
•Always instruct children NOT to rock, bounce or lean
•NEVER use the trailer off-road.  This may result in damage to the trailer and or serious injury to the passengers
•Do not use the trailer in extreme weather, such as heat, cold, wind or rain.  Passengers must be clothed appropriately  
  to prevailing weather conditions.

PRE-RIDE SAFETY CHECK:

1. Check to insure hitch clamp is tight
2. Check to insure hitch safety strap is secure
3. BUCKLE UP!  Check seat harness and secure all baggage
4. Inspect bike and trailer condition before each use
5. HELMETS ON!  Insure rider and child helmets are on and secure
6. Check tire air pressure.  Always maintain between 35 and 40 PSI (between 2.5 and 3.5 bar)
7. The bicycle to which the trailer will be attached should be inspected by a qualified bicycle mechanic before attaching      
    the trailer to it.
